Its members offer everything from respite support, community care services, independent living solutions and befriending to sports massage, counselling, stress management, herbal medicine and therapeutic gardening.
And now the organisation is looking for a strategic development officer and a project co- ordinator to help shape the future of community-led care in the area.
Olivia Robertson is from The Home Straight – which offers independent living solutions for older people – and is a director of the Care and Wellbeing Co-op.
She said: “We offer a community-led approach to the provision of rural care and wellbeing and work towards helping our clients find the best solutions to their care and wellbeing needs.
“The co- op also plays an important role as an advocate for reform in adult social care in Scotland and in raising awareness of the work that its members do and how they are finding innovative solutions to the provision of care and wellbeing services, which in the current climate is more vital than it ever has been.
“We currently have vacancies on the team for a strategic development officer and a project coordinator and are looking for people with a good understanding of the care sector and of the political landscape for rural community-led care to join us.
“This is an exciting opportunity to be part of an innovative project – the only one of its kind in Scotland – which has the potential to make a real and positive difference to the lives of people in our communities.”
